Sample Size and Geometric Morphometrics Methodology Impact the Evaluation of Morphological Variation

Sample size and view selection significantly impact two-dimensional geometric morphometric (2DGM) analyses of bat skull shape. Preliminary analyses using multiple views, elements, and sample sizes ensure robust conclusions in morphological evolution studies.
Area of Science:
- Evolutionary biology
- Comparative anatomy
- Morphological evolution
Background:
- Two-dimensional geometric morphometrics (2DGM) is crucial for studying morphological evolution.
- 2DGM outcomes can be influenced by sample size, selected views, and elements, often due to practical constraints.
- Understanding these influences is vital for reliable evolutionary and taxonomic studies.
Purpose of the Study:
- To evaluate the impact of sample size on 2DGM analyses of bat skull shape.
- To assess the concordance of different skull views and elements in 2DGM.
- To determine if 2DGM can differentiate morphologically cryptic bat species.
Main Methods:
- Utilized large intraspecific sample sizes (>70) for two bat species: Lasiurus borealis and Nycticeius humeralis.
- Performed 2DGM analyses on multiple skull views and elements.
- Assessed shape variation, variance, and centroid size, and compared results across different sample sizes and views.
Main Results:
- Reduced sample size altered mean shape and increased shape variance.
- Shape differences were inconsistent across skull views and elements.
- 2DGM successfully differentiated the cryptic species Lasiurus borealis and Lasiurus seminolus across all views and elements.
Conclusions:
- Sample size and the choice of 2D views/elements critically affect 2DGM results.
- No single sample size or view is universally optimal; selection must align with research questions.
- Preliminary analyses with varied parameters are recommended for robust 2DGM conclusions.
